What Are the Best Combs for Curly Hair to Prevent Breakage?
When it comes to curly hair, not all combs are created equal. The best combs are usually wide-toothed. They have bigger spaces between the teeth, which helps to gently separate the curls without pulling them apart. This is really important because curly hair is often more fragile. If you use a fine-toothed comb, it can snag and break the hair. A wide-toothed comb lets you glide through the hair easily. Another great option is a detangling comb. These curly hair brush combs are special because they are designed to help remove knots without causing damage. They often have flexible teeth that bend instead of breaking the hair.
You might also want to try a wooden comb. Wooden combs are gentle on the hair and help to reduce static. This is especially helpful in winter when dry air can make hair frizzy. Comb manufacturers like Ningbo Glory Magic make wooden combs that are perfect for curly hair. They are smooth and do not create friction, which can lead to breakage. Some people also love using their fingers to detangle their curls. This method allows for more control and is very gentle. Remember, the goal is to be kind to your curls. Always start from the ends and work your way up to avoid pulling.
How to Choose the Right Comb for Curly Hair to Minimize Damage?
Choosing the right comb for your curly hair can be a fun experience. First, think about the size of your curls. If you have big, loose curls, a wide-toothed comb is perfect. If your curls are tighter, you might want a comb that is designed for that specific curl type. Look for combs that say they are for curly or textured hair. Another thing to keep in mind is the material of the comb. Plastic combs can create static, which makes hair frizzy. Instead, go for a comb made of wood or rubber. These materials are much gentler on the hair.
It’s also important to think about when and how you use your comb. The best time to comb curly hair is when it is wet and has some conditioner in it. This helps the comb glide through the hair easily and reduces breakage. If you comb dry hair, you may find more knots and tangles. So, keep that in mind when styling your hair! Finally, don’t forget to check the teeth of the comb. They should be smooth without any sharp edges. Sharp edges can snag hair and cause breakage. How Do Different Comb Materials Affect Hair Breakage in Curly Textures?
The material of a comb can make a big difference for people with curly hair. When choosing a comb, it is important to understand how different materials can affect your hair. For example, plastic combs are very common and can be found in many stores. However, not all plastic combs are the same. Some plastic combs have sharp edges that can snag your curls and cause breakage. If you choose a plastic comb, look for one that has rounded teeth.
Another good option is wooden combs. Wooden combs are gentle on curly hair and help to reduce breakage. The smooth surface of wood helps your curls glide through without pulling or tearing. This is great because curly hair can be more fragile than straight hair.
Metal combs are not usually the best choice for curly hair. They can be very rough and can easily cause breakage. If you have curly hair, it’s better to stick with plastic or wood.

How to Properly Use a Comb to Maintain Healthy Curly Hair?
Using a comb the right way is just as important as the comb you choose. If you have curly hair, you should be very gentle when you comb it. Start by using a wide-tooth comb to avoid pulling or breaking your curls. First, make sure your hair is wet or damp. It’s easier to comb curly hair when it’s wet because it’s less likely to break.
Next, apply a little bit of conditioner or leave-in treatment to help your hair stay smooth. This will help the comb glide through your hair without getting stuck. Start combing from the ends of your hair and work your way up to the roots. This way, you can gently remove any knots without pulling on your curls.
If you hit a snag, don’t yank on the comb. Instead, try to gently work through the knot with your fingers before using the comb again. If you are too rough, you can cause breakage, and that’s not what you want for your beautiful curls.
After you are done combing, avoid using a brush. Brushes can cause frizz and breakage in curly hair. Instead, let your curls dry naturally or use a diffuser on a blow dryer if you need to dry them quickly.
